The Yamaha YZF-R3 (2019+) in the real world
The R3 wears supersport bodywork, but its clip-ons mount above the top triple clamp — the resulting position is a light forward lean that new riders acclimatise to within a weekend, not a wrists-down crouch. With a 780 mm seat on a physically small, light motorcycle, it’s among the easiest sportbikes in the country to manage at a standstill, which is why it’s been a fixture of Australian learner courses and club-level racing grids alike.
The R3’s size is its defining fit trait in both directions. Smaller riders describe it as the first faired bike that feels scaled to them. Riders approaching 180 cm and beyond fit on it — plenty race them — but the short reach to the bars and high-ish knee position mean the road-riding experience gets cramped on anything longer than an hour.
Who the YZF-R3 fits
Excellent for riders 155–170 cm: low seat, slim mid-section, light clutch and a sub-170 kg kerb weight make stops undramatic.
The mild clip-on position is a good training ground for a later supersport without punishing your wrists now.
Riders over ~180 cm will feel large on it — knees high and elbows close. Fine for track days, tiring for touring.
The pillion seat is vestigial; if you regularly carry a passenger, look at a larger platform.
Common fit & comfort changes
Rearsets — The classic track upgrade — raises and sets the pegs back for clearance and a more committed knee position. Road riders rarely need them.
Comfort or reshaped seat — Adds support for longer road rides; some options add a touch of height, which taller owners use to open the knee angle.
Lowering links — Available for very short riders, though most find the stock 780 mm seat already workable — check your reach in the simulator before spending.

Is the Yamaha R3 too small for tall riders?
It depends what you use it for. Riders over 180 cm race R3s happily, but for road use the short seat-to-bar reach and high knee position feel cramped after about an hour. If most of your riding is commuting or touring, a mid-size platform will fit better.
Is the R3 riding position beginner friendly?
Yes. Despite the full fairing, the bars mount above the triple clamp, so the forward lean is mild. Combined with the 780 mm seat and low weight, it’s one of the least intimidating sportbike positions on sale.
Seat height & wheelbase come straight from the manufacturer’s published specs, verified across the maker’s site, media reviews and spec databases.
Handlebar & footpeg positions aren’t published by any manufacturer. Where a true side-profile photo exists, we mark five reference points on it (front & rear axle, seat, grip, peg) and convert pixels to millimetres using the known wheelbase as the scale. Where it doesn’t, we research the grip and peg heights and estimate the horizontal reach from class-typical geometry.
Every result is cross-checked against how reviewers describe the bike’s posture (upright / sporty / committed), and each bike page carries a data-confidence badge so you can see how solid its numbers are.
The drawing is a clean schematic — one shared template per bike type (naked, sport, cruiser, adventure, touring, dirt), anchored to each bike’s real seat, grip and peg coordinates — so you compare riding positions, not paint jobs.
Your figure is a stick model built from your height and inseam using standard body-proportion ratios, then posed by inverse kinematics — hips on the seat, hands on the bars, feet on the pegs — with the same posture solver for every bike.
Bottom line: seat height & wheelbase are hard data; handlebar/footpeg geometry and ground reach are calibrated estimates (see each bike’s data-confidence badge). Always sit on the real bike before you buy.
